URLife: A Revolution in Well-Being
Co-founded by Ram Charan and Upasana, URLife is a movement that uses technology to promote healthy living rather than just a wellness platform. The platform provides an extensive array of services that are customized to fit into busy corporate lifestyles, such as virtual consultations, on-demand doctor appointments, and fitness programs. This innovative strategy is having a significant impact on India’s workforce, especially with its 550+ Occupational Health Centers (OHCs) supporting the health of more than two million people.

An Innovative Collaboration with HPCL
By extending its wellness offerings across 94 HPCL facilities, URLife has worked with Hindustan Petroleum Corporation Limited (HPCL) to elevate corporate wellness to new heights. The partnership offers weekly doctor visits, round-the-clock virtual medical care, and emergency management solutions, elevating a complete health ecosystem. This program ensures that wellness is woven into daily living and is not restricted to employees or their families.

Encouraging Women and Creating Inclusive Environments
The goals of Upasana extend beyond workplace well-being. She is dedicated to creating inclusive, long-lasting ecosystems. She recently introduced a women-only entrepreneurship platform that acts as a “shark tank” for female entrepreneurs in the wellness sector. Her goal is to reshape the wellness sector and the role of women in business by establishing an environment where women can take the lead, innovate, and have a social impact.
